[QUOTE]Originally posted by GlobalOne: [QB] Some social habits can not be explained and it will not be clearly understood since there is no homogeneous tendencies. Similar to the fact that when kids are 18 boys or girls they can leave their parents house and live independently in the west, or women kissing each other on the checks, or youngsters having other sex companions (boyfriend/girlfriend) or premarital sex. So some social habits comes unsuspectingly natural to some seems odd and strange to others. and as newcomer said it is not just in the Arab world. It is a sign of endearment and trust or friendship. It does not necessarily mean a public display of affection that is allowed for men and prohibited for women as you can see women also walking holding hands. I 'm assured that the reporter is a biased one with a certain agenda. since she did not see the other gender public display of this social habit. [/QB][/QUOTE]
